Chinese Orange Chicken
- 4 boneless skinless chicken breasts, cut into cubes
- 1 garlic clove, minced
- 1 slice ginger, minced
- Marinade
- 1 tablespoon dry sherry
- 1/2 tablespoon cornstarch
- Sauce
- 1/3 cup orange juice
- 2 tablespoons dark soy sauce
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il
- 1 teaspoon brown sugar
- 1/4 teaspoon chili paste
- Place the cubed chicken in a bowl with the marinade ingredients for 30 minutes.
- While the chicken is marinating, prepare the sauce ingredients.
- When the chicken is nearly ready, heat the wok and add a bit of oil.
- Throw in the garlic and ginger and stir-fry until aromatic.
- Add the chicken and stir-fry until it changes color.
- Push up to the sides of the wok, making a well in the middle.
- Add the sauce.
- Mix the sauce and the chicken together.
- Stir-fry for another minute and serve hot.
